How they compare
Uruguay currently reports 820 against 781 in Brunei, a difference of 39.
Across all 5 years both countries report, Uruguay has been ahead every year.
Brunei ranks 151st and Uruguay ranks 150th of 180 countries.
Uruguay has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Brunei | Uruguay |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 2,782 | 21,605 | 18,823 | Uruguay |
| 1990s | 1,488 | 8,700 | 7,212 | Uruguay |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
